Government introduced tea growing in Zombo district in 2014 through the Northern Uganda Social Action Fund-NUSAF. A tea plantation was established on a piece of land measuring 3000 acres belonging to Alur Kingdom. A group of farmers in Zeu Sub County embraced the tea production.

Beatrice Nabuyoga, a resident of Luzira village, Busiya parish in Bulambuli district and her bedridden husband have sheltered some of the victims in their home. Nabuyoga, a peasant farmer says her family decided to offer about 10 empty rooms in their home to host the landslide victims after seeing many of them suffering with nowhere to sleep.
